Erik Bottcher
Profile
Erik Bottcher is an American politician currently serving as a member of the New York State Senate, having assumed office in February 2026. Prior to his election to the state senate, he served as a member of the New York City Council representing the 3rd district from 2022 to 2026. Throughout his career, Bottcher has been a prominent advocate for LGBTQ+ rights, mental health services, and housing affordability. His political activism began in his youth, and he later worked as a community liaison for the New York City Council and the governor's office, playing a key role in the 2011 passage of marriage equality in New York.
